May be because Aurigny currenty have ATR 72-600 G-PEMB out of action due to a tail strike, it has not flown since May and is currently shown as stored in Dinard, France. Prior to that it spent 3 weeks in Toulouse, presumably for inspection and possible repair. That it’s now in store suggests it may have suffered severe unrepairable or very expensive structural damage.According to FR24, ZT are initially deploying said E190 on behalf of GR, so yesterday’s visit may have been in anticipation of it making an appearance on the GCI run at some point, perhaps.
